#2c4c4e basic color information

#2c4c4e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#2c4c4e has decimal index of: 2903118, is composed of 17.3% red, 29.8% green and 30.6% blue. #2c4c4e in CMYK color model, is composed of 43.6% cyan, 2.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black.
#333366 is the closest web-safe color to #2c4c4e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
